WebThe Whip poor- will occasionally may be double-brooded (Mills 1986), but this has not been reported for Texas. The Whip-poor-will forages visually and is thus more active on … WebStudies have shown that the 19–21 day incubation period of whip-poor-wills ends about 10 days before a full moon. WebDescription Adult whip-poor-wills have short, rounded wings and are able to turn quickly when pursuing prey. They have cryptically colored plumage with gray, brown, and black mixed in a pattern like dry leaves on a forest … WebAug 25, 2024 · Whippoorwills and their related species belong to a family of birds called the nightjars ( Caprimulgidae) and are mostly active at night.
